Distance Between Hitch Pin and Ball Center on Weigh Safe Adjustable Ball Mount # WS37MR

Question:
What is the shank length pin holes to ball center, so I can know if itll clear trailer tongue jack and tailgate when hitched.

Expert Reply:
Hey John, the Weigh Safe Adjustable Ball Mount part # WS37MR has two hitch pin holes with the closer one measuring 8-1/2 inches between the hitch pin hole and the ball center and the further hole measuring 9-5/8 inches. Would either of these work for you?
